Output 8863485d70ec91bbfb40eb83cbdcf0ca03bfd111cb335532109541fb4a205f7c:1

value
62817102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77b68483e6b218dfc5001240b5005ba75a2d977b OP_EQUALVERIFY OP_CHECKSIG
address
1Buz4NnYKyehVbKBTgPGjfab95TnkcCCG5
transaction
8863485d70ec91bbfb40eb83cbdcf0ca03bfd111cb335532109541fb4a205f7c
confirmations
423242
spent
true